I remember the first time my family started eating chilli bak kwa some years ago... This tastes like what I remembered! I still like the original traditional flavour the most; nonetheless this signature chilli version is pretty addictive! Also a little reminiscent of the Makan Vegan chilli sauce that they also sell at the Bak Kwa shop. The texture is of course great as with the original flavour. Perfectly chewy yet tender with slightly crispy charred edges - made using Omni mince meat so there is a great mouthfeel. (Not to mention the fact that Omni mince meat is high in protein and fibre; plus low in carbs, fat, and calories!) You can get this from the Makan Vegan Bak Kwa retail shop, a few units away from the Geylang Coffeeshop. Good texture, slightly chewy which i like. Not a fan of spice but i bought the chilli flavor because it has more depth. Packs a punch but ok after a few bites and doesnt burn the tummy. Not too sweet which is a definite plus. Each pack is 500gm (about $48) and has about 7 individually vaccuumed sealed pieces. Was told it was made with omni meat. I bought it at Makan Vegan’s retail shop in geylang and you can try before buying. Would buy again for CNY.

Although there are other great vegan bak kwas (? can I make bak kwa plural like this LOL) around in Singapore now, what makes this stand out is that it is chilli flavoured! 🌶️ Addictively savoury and spicy flavour profile, similar to what I remember from the meat versions of chilli bak kwa. (Flashback to CNY visiting at my grandmother's house in my teenage years; now I can do it with a vegan version~ 🥹) As with the original flavour, the mouthfeel is pretty good, made using @omnifoods #omnifoods 'minced meat'. 🧧🧨 While the previous version was firmer and chewier, the new version is now significantly softer and more tender.
